摘要
针对TI公司TMS320C6678多核处理器的特性要求,提出了一种基于多核处理器的电源管理系统的设计方法。该系统在实现TMS320C6678对各路电源的幅值特性要求以及对所需各路电源时序控制的同时,可以完成内核电压的动态调控。经验证,TMS320C6678处理器在该电源管理系统下工作稳定。
        A design method of power management system based on multi-core processors is proposed,according to the characteristics of TMS320C6678 which is designed by Texas Instrument Corporation.The system not only implements the amplitude requirement and sequential control of each power rail,but also achieves the dynamic regulation for the core voltage.Experiments show that TMS320C6678 processor performs stably under the power management system.
